使用QT的qmake工具生成VS工程
来源:互联网 发布:win10怎么重置网络配置 编辑:程序博客网 时间:2024/05/22 08:21
本文主要讲怎么使用qmake工具生成的VS的工程文件,对于QT的库不做说明。qt的安装很简单,一路下一步就OK,安装完看看qt的bin目录是否添加中环境变量path中,如果没有,请手动添加。
首先,使用的代码例子是QT安装目录下的qmake的示例文件,路径为:C:\QT\4.8.1\examples\qmake\tutorial。
将里面的代码拷贝到一个新的文件夹,以免破坏原来的代码。我的目录是F:\Work\Test\QtDemo。
打开cmd,输入下面的命令“qmake -project”,回车,如下图:
会发现在目录生成一个叫QtDemo.pro的pro文件,可以用记事本打开看看,内容如下:
1
2
3
4
5
6
7
8
9
10
11
12
######################################################################
# Automatically generated by qmake (2.01a) ?? ?? 3 11:06:25 2012
######################################################################
TEMPLATE
=
app
TARGET
=
DEPENDPATH
+
=
.
INCLUDEPATH
+
=
.
# Input
HEADERS
+
=
hello.h
SOURCES
+
=
hello.cpp main.cpp
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
######################################################################
# Automatically generated by qmake (2.01a) ??? ?? 13 15:43:14 2010
######################################################################
TEMPLATE
=
app
TARGET
=
ImageDisplay
DEPENDPATH
+
=
.
INCLUDEPATH
+
=
.
DESTDIR
=
..
/
Bin
/
Release
CONFIG( debug, debug|release ){
DESTDIR
=
..
/
Bin
/
debug
BUILD_NAME
=
Debug
}
# Input
HEADERS
+
=
MainWindow.h \
ImageColorRef.h \
SOURCES
+
=
main.cpp \
MainWindow.cpp \
ImageColorRef.cpp \
FORMS
+
=
MainWindow.ui \
RC_FILE
=
MainWindow.rc
win32{
INCLUDEPATH
+
=
F:\RsSrcDir\
3rdPart
\gdal\include \
LIBS
+
=
-
lF:\RsSrcDir\
3rdPart
\gdal\lib\gdal_i \
}
好了,生成pro文件到此结束,下面继续在命令行里面输入:“qmake -t vcapp ”,会生成VS的工程文件,如下图:
然后用VS打开工程文件编译就OK了。
原文地址:http://blog.csdn.net/liminlu0314/article/details/7627600
- 使用QT的qmake工具生成VS工程
- 使用QT的qmake工具生成VS工程
- 使用QT的qmake工具生成VS工程 .
- 使用QT的qmake工具生成VS工程
- QT的qmake 通过pro文件生成vs工程
- qmake生成vs的vcproj/sln工程
- qmake生成vs的vcproj/sln工程
- qmake生成VS的vcproj/sln工程文件
- qmake生成VS的vcproj/sln工程文件
- 利用Qt的qmake创建vc工程
- 利用Qt的qmake创建vc工程
- 利用Qt的qmake创建vc工程
- 利用Qt的qmake创建vc工程
- QT 中qmake 的使用
- 使用qmake 单独生成Qt程序
- 使用qmake工具构建QT应用程序
- QMake 生成VS2013的工程文件
- QMake 生成VS2013的工程文件
- dataGridView行高自适应
- android中的ListView数据量大时如何提高效率。。。。
- “烫烫烫烫烫烫烫烫烫烫烫烫烫..."
- 赋值语句2
- PSOBP神经网络+3QMFCC
- 使用QT的qmake工具生成VS工程
- java.util.concurrent.CopyOnWriteArrayList
- linux的du和df命令
- 关于ARM的22个常用概念
- ADO 版本问题导致了程序不能在其他电脑运行
- LearningFromData The perceptron learning problem
- Android NDK开发(1)----- Java与C互相调用实例详解 .
- web project项目到MyEclipese中,在Package Explorer中工程前面有一个红色感叹号
- 大家好哇,好久木有写blog了